In today’s digital world, data security is more important than ever before. With cyber threats on the rise, it’s crucial to take steps to protect your sensitive information from prying eyes. That’s where cryptography comes into play.
The Basics of Cryptography
Cryptography is a complex field with many different techniques and methods. However, at its core, it involves two main processes: encryption and decryption.
Encryption is the process of transforming plaintext (unencrypted text) into ciphertext (encrypted text) using a cryptographic algorithm. The ciphertext is then transmitted over an insecure network, where it can be intercepted by an attacker. To access the original message, the ciphertext must be decrypted using a decryption key.
Decryption is the process of transforming ciphertext back into plaintext using the decryption key. The decryption key is kept secret and only known to the intended recipient, ensuring that the message remains secure even if it falls into the wrong hands.
Applications of Cryptography
Cryptography has a wide range of applications in modern society. Here are some examples:
- Secure communication: Cryptography is used to secure communication over the internet, such as email and instant messaging. By encrypting messages before they are transmitted, the information remains secure even if it is intercepted by a hacker.
- Financial transactions: Cryptography is used in financial transactions, such as online banking and e-commerce, to protect sensitive data like credit card numbers and personal identification information.
- Data protection: Cryptography is used to protect sensitive data stored on computers and servers. By encrypting the data, even if it is accessed by an attacker, they will not be able to read it without the decryption key.
- Digital signatures: Cryptography is used to create digital signatures, which are used to verify the authenticity of a document or message. For example, when you sign an email, your email client uses cryptography to create a digital signature that verifies your identity and ensures that the message has not been tampered with.
Why Cryptography is Essential for Data Protection
In today’s digital world, data breaches are becoming more common. Cybercriminals use a variety of techniques to gain access to sensitive information, including phishing attacks, malware, and brute-force attacks. Without proper security measures in place, your data can be easily compromised, leading to identity theft, financial loss, and other serious consequences.
Cryptography is essential for protecting your data because it provides a high level of security that is difficult for attackers to breach. By encrypting your data, even if an attacker gains access to it, they will not be able to read it without the decryption key. Additionally, cryptographic algorithms are designed to be resistant to attacks, making them a reliable and effective way to protect your data.
FAQs
1. What is the difference between symmetric and asymmetric cryptography?
Symmetric cryptography uses the same key for both encryption and decryption, while asymmetric cryptography uses two different keys (a public key and a private key) for encryption and decryption, respectively.
2. Is it possible to break a cryptographic algorithm?
While it is theoretically possible to break a cryptographic algorithm, it would require an enormous amount of computational power and time. In practice, it is extremely difficult to break most modern cryptographic algorithms.
3. Can I use my own encryption key?
Yes, you can use your own encryption key for securing your data. However, it’s important to keep the key secure and not share it with anyone.